Output cbb628de5401de06bb6ca8b7b59eaf3eebbcd6ba0085e05ace6ee1888903febe:1

value
101439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 991ff9a82810f06d768fea516224770ef0d88fcf OP_EQUAL
address
3Fefca5jWyXwmaSyeX3xR6yngW84iUHPgr
transaction
cbb628de5401de06bb6ca8b7b59eaf3eebbcd6ba0085e05ace6ee1888903febe
confirmations
272701
spent
true